Default Set up help! 37 OL

Last year I got the new to me boat and here were the results I saw before I had a major melt down. Running 34p bravo 1 props w bmax drives 1.26 ratio and imco lower. Best I saw was 5050 Rpm and 97 gps. It was dead flat water 3/4 tank of fuel and 5 people. If you calculate that w the Bamm slip calculator its 25%. Engines were about 925 hp ea.

Had a valve go and was down as of June 25th. Engines are getting rebuilt and Im going w about 725 hp per side. Where should I start w props? I was thinking of trying a 30p 5 blade and maybe even 28's. I want to get the slip numbers down into the teens and still need to talk to the builder as to max rpms I should be lookin for but wanna hear some thoughts.
